Partner and Interconnect Management Market: The Partner and Interconnect Management Market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the increasing demand for efficient network management and seamless interconnection among enterprises. As businesses expand globally, the need for effective management of partnerships and interconnections becomes paramount. This market encompasses solutions and services that facilitate the management of partner relationships, interconnect agreements, and the optimization of network operations.

Partner and Interconnect Management Market is projected to grow from USD 2.54 Billion in 2025 to USD 5.16 Billion by 2034,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.84% during the forecast period (2025 – 2034).

Key Market Segments The Partner and Interconnect Management Market is segmented based on offering, agreement type, deployment mode, operating system, application, telecom operator type, and location.

By Offering Solutions: Comprehensive software platforms that enable the management of partner relationships and interconnect operations.

Services: Professional services including consulting, implementation, and support for partner and interconnect management solutions.

By Agreement Type Bilateral Agreements: Mutual agreements between two parties for interconnection and partnership.

Unilateral Agreements: One-sided agreements initiated by a single party.

By Deployment Mode Cloud-Based: Solutions hosted on cloud platforms, offering scalability and flexibility.

On-Premises: Solutions deployed within the organization's infrastructure for greater control.

Market Drivers Several factors are driving the growth of the Partner and Interconnect Management Market:

Rising Demand for Global Connectivity: The increasing need for seamless communication and data exchange across borders is propelling the demand for efficient partner and interconnect management solutions.

Growth of Cloud Computing: The proliferation of cloud services has introduced complexities in network management, necessitating robust solutions to manage interconnections and partnerships effectively.

Regulatory Compliance Requirements: Organizations are adopting partner and interconnect management solutions to ensure compliance with regulatory standards and avoid penalties.

Operational Efficiency: These solutions help in optimizing network operations, reducing costs, and enhancing service quality.
